Permalink
Switch branches/tags
Nothing to show
Commits on Oct 11, 2011
  1. * Introduce Plugin::MAINCOMPATIBILITY who prevent old plugin to load if

    showi committed Oct 11, 2011
    lesser than Shoze::VERSION
    * Session now export _lh object (i18n handle) who reflect user
    preferences and permit plugin internationalization
    * Plugin 'Users' conform to our new spec :]
    * Running after 0.0.8 finalization ... Freeze Don't Move, blalblalba ...
Commits on Oct 4, 2011
  1. * Enhancing parameters filter for plugins, each command can register

    showi committed Oct 4, 2011
    specific filters. Filters can be a simple Regexp, an Array of regexp or
    a sub.
Commits on Oct 3, 2011
  1. Introduce i18n Module

    showi committed Oct 3, 2011
Commits on Oct 2, 2011
Commits on Sep 30, 2011
  1. Add # for input filtering ...

    showi committed Sep 30, 2011
  2. * Porting plugins to new API

    showi committed Sep 30, 2011
    * Working on POE::WS (REST API)
    * Documentation stub
Commits on Sep 29, 2011
  1. ...

    showi committed Sep 29, 2011
Commits on Sep 28, 2011
  1. Major change on plugin system

    showi committed Sep 28, 2011
    - Each plugin reside in his own directory
    - Plugin can add database interface to Shoze::Db
    
    Writing POD documentation stubs
Commits on Sep 27, 2011
  1. Writing POD documentation (stub)

    showi committed Sep 27, 2011
Commits on Sep 26, 2011
  1. Using POE::Out as à central point for sending message

    showi committed Sep 26, 2011
    - Introduce BotLogs, a log facility for in/out messages
    - Introduce Fortunes plugin
Commits on Sep 25, 2011
  1. Cleaning

    showi committed Sep 25, 2011
Commits on Sep 24, 2011
  1. Freezing process!

    showi committed Sep 24, 2011
  2. Freezing process...

    showi committed Sep 24, 2011
  3. Freezing process...

    showi committed Sep 24, 2011
Commits on Sep 23, 2011
  1. Forgot icestats.pl :@

    showi committed Sep 23, 2011
  2. Improving SubTask

    showi committed Sep 23, 2011
    * YAML Serialisation of data
    * Introduce SubTask::Request and SubTask::Response for better
    encapsulation
    
    Introduce new plugins to retrieve IceCast statistics, hard coded value
    must be removed from it :)
  3. Consolidation of existing code!

    showi committed Sep 23, 2011
Commits on Sep 21, 2011
  1. Continue porting to new API

    showi committed Sep 21, 2011
    Import insulte and carambar data into EasySentence
Commits on Sep 18, 2011
  1. Porting plugins to our new API :P

    showi committed Sep 18, 2011
Commits on Sep 16, 2011
  1. Major change in the underlying database (need to track channel users...)

    showi committed Sep 16, 2011
    Remove some dependency between Shoze::Configuration and Shoze::Db
    Moving to Singleton design for Shoze::Db and Shoze::Configuration
    Lot of thing are broken :)
Commits on Sep 11, 2011
  1. Cleaning ...

    showi committed Sep 11, 2011
Commits on Sep 10, 2011
  1. Cleaning

    showi committed Sep 10, 2011
Commits on Sep 9, 2011
  1. Cleaning code

    showi committed Sep 9, 2011
  2. Cleaning code

    showi committed Sep 9, 2011
    - Now Session use SynchObject.
    - get_by in Db::Channels now take an hash like all his sibling. 
    
    Must be tested to track introduced bugs!
  3. Introduce POE::SubTask so we can run command in the background!

    showi committed Sep 9, 2011
    Using subtask to display TLD from IANA web site.
Commits on Sep 8, 2011
Commits on Sep 7, 2011
  1. Introduce EasySentence(insulte, proverbe, carambar), an easy way for the

    showi committed Sep 7, 2011
    bot to say something!
    Decode all db field to utf-8 when we fetch value from database!
    Introduce a little wrapper to start the bot as a daemon
Commits on Sep 6, 2011
  1. Forgot Web Service yaml configuration file.

    showi committed Sep 6, 2011
    Update README
  2. - Working on channel management

    showi committed Sep 6, 2011
    - Removing hard configuration, we use our yaml configuration files
    instead
Commits on Sep 5, 2011
  1. Running bot after CPANIFICATION!

    showi committed Sep 5, 2011
  2. Testing CPAN required module

    showi committed Sep 5, 2011
Commits on Sep 4, 2011
  1. Repackaging into CPAN distribution for easier deployment on test

    showi committed Sep 4, 2011
    machine!
    !!! WORK IN PROGRESS !!!
Commits on Sep 3, 2011
  1. Working on REST API

    showi committed Sep 3, 2011
    - Request signing is functionnal